One of the biggest problems for a new slide player to overcome is “slide rattle” and clang ,when the slide catches the wrong string in the wrong way and the string rattles against it . it can make your tune sound like 2 skeletons humping on a tin roof using a tin can as a condom . ;-)
So, I pondered for a while on what would help new slide players avoid this discouraging hurtle.
I came up with an idea.. and thought , “that might work” , but I never really got around to trying it out . till last night . And guess what? It not only works,… but works damn well!
I figured guitar mutes have a felt or furry surface , but I would need something that the string could cut through or find its way through to get to the hard surface of a slide, yet dampen it on the way in, and out ,and to a lighter accidental touch .
The solution ?....wrap the slide in yarn . in a spiral fashion , no glue , no cross-knit , just wrap it like a string on a tuner . the string gets through the “fur” and hits the metal , but is buffered on the way in and out . and any accidental contact with other strings is hushed , as is open ringing . Giving you a warm , clear, un-klangy sound . it’s actually hard to make it rattle deliberately it works so well.
I could not believe this worked so well and after a google search is seems nobody else has tried it .
I could sell these like hotcakes , but the concept is so simple to diy. . so , I am sharing it with you . anywho , this is how I made mine .
Use “SWIRL” type yarn. (normal yarn may work but, this is what I used . )
Pull out a long piece of yarn about the length of your arm x3 and cut it .. run a piece along one side of the slide , hold the top , take the other end of yarn and start wrapping around the slide (leave the short piece running along the slide and cover it as you wrap it .
Full wrap then cut and tie the ends in a double knot .
Tada ! try the witch wrap . you will be glad you did , and your rattle is gone / cured ! but you can still play slide as usual . (maybe pushing a bit harder or you may loose some sustain , but you'll get it, , and eventually it will train you to not need it by adding natural confidence )
